A street lamp inspired the Castiglioni brothers’ design, demonstrating Achille Castiglioni’s motto that “design demands observation.” By inserting a steel arch into a heavy marble pedestal, the designers created a lamp that is able to illuminate objects eight feet away from its base—far enough to light the middle of a dining table. Composed simply of a polypropylene battery holder connected to two PVC wires with a small bulb at each end, Nasa is a flexible little device that can be clipped just about anywhere. The exhibit also showcased several historic Castiglioni lights, among them bestsellers such as Arco (1962)—now a symbol of midcentury modernism with its slender, arched form—and Snoopy (1967), a nod to the iconic cartoon beagle, with its black snout-like shade and veined marble base. In production from 1962 to 1965, Ventosa was once promoted through a collaboration with Johnny Walker—proving that even a bottle of the whiskey could be a Ventosa surface.
